Why is PbO called litharge?
Litharge (from Greek lithargyros, lithos (stone) + argyros (silver) λιθάργυρος) is one of the natural mineral forms of lead(II) oxide, PbO. Litharge is a secondary mineral which forms from the oxidation of galena ores. It forms as coatings and encrustations with internal tetragonal crystal structure.

How is PbO formed?
Lead oxide can occur as a transition form in oxidation/reduction process of the PbO2/Pb(II) couple. It is particularly stable in alkaline solutions. Anodic oxidation of Pb results in the growth of β-PbO, which can then be transformed to α-PbO. The structure of PbO deposit depends on hydroxide (NaOH) concentration.

What is the Iupac name of PbO2?
PbO2 is an oxide where the oxidation state of lead is +4 with chemical name Lead (IV) oxide. It is also called lead dioxide, or anhydrous Plumbic acid, or Plumbic oxide.
What is red lead oxide?
Lead(II,IV) oxide, also called red lead or minium, is the inorganic compound with the formula. . A bright red or orange solid, it is used as pigment, in the manufacture of batteries, and rustproof primer paints.

How is pbo2 amphoteric?
Lead dioxide is an amphoteric compound with prevalent acidic properties. It dissolves in strong bases to form the hydroxyplumbate ion, [Pb(OH)6]2−: PbO2 + 2 NaOH + 2 H2O → Na2[Pb(OH)6] It also reacts with basic oxides in the melt, yielding orthoplumbates M4[PbO4].

What is the structure of PbO2?
PbO2 is an oxide where the oxidation state of lead is +4 with chemical name Lead (IV) oxide. It is also called lead dioxide, or anhydrous Plumbic acid, or Plumbic oxide. It is a powerful oxidizing agent. Plumbic oxide is a dark-brown crystalline powder which is insoluble in water and alcohol.

What is red lead formula?
Pb3O4Lead(II,IV) oxide / Formula
Lead (II,IV) oxide, also called, red lead or triplumbic tetroxide, is a red crystalline or amorphous pigment. Its chemical formula is Pb3O4 or 2PbO. PbO2. It is used in the manufacture of batteries.
